What they do

A Registered Nurse provides medical care and treatment, educates patients about their conditions, and provides emotional support to patients and families. Works in hospitals, schools, clinics or community health centers. Works under the supervision of a physician or other specialist, and serves as the primary point of care for patients in a hospital setting. May specialize in emergency room work, or treatment for a particular condition, or specialize in working with infants, the elderly or other patient groups. May work as an advanced practice specialists and prescribe medications in addition to offering specialty care.

Job Description

Adventist Health seeks an experienced RN Lead for our Labor & Delivery and Postpartum units, Full Time Nights. In this leadership role, you will provide compassionate, evidence-based care for mothers and newborns while coordinating unit workflows and mentoring bedside nurses. Responsibilities include maternal-fetal assessment, medication administration, supporting deliveries, postpartum recovery, newborn care, and patient education. You'll collaborate with a multidisciplinary team in our faith-based environment, promoting whole-person care, safety, and quality outcomes while fostering teamwork and professional growth. Responsibilities Provide and coordinate nursing care for laboring, postpartum, and newborn patients on night shift Lead and mentor RN team, assigning patients and overseeing clinical workflows Monitor maternal and fetal status, interpret clinical data, and escalate concerns promptly Administer medications, IV therapies, and pain management per provider orders and protocols Collaborate with physicians, midwives, and interdisciplinary teams to ensure safe, family-centered care Educate patients and families on birth, postpartum recovery, and newborn care Ensure compliance with hospital policies, safety standards, and regulatory requirements Participate in quality improvement, staff education, and shared governance initiatives Required Skills Labor and delivery nursing Postpartum nursing Newborn assessment and care Fetal monitoring interpretation IV therapy and medication administration Charge/lead nurse coordination Electronic health record (EHR) documentation Emergency response in obstetrics (e.g., hemorrhage, preeclampsia) Patient and family education Interdisciplinary care coordination
